JavaScrip系列
文章平均质量分 81
JavaScript由浅入深讲解
千锋HTML5大前端
让优秀的教育资源不再孤芳自赏,与你共享。
展开
-
JavaScript全解析——npm
1.4.下载时, 会去下载指定的第三方包, 如果第三方包用到了其他的第三方包, 会一起下载到 node_modules 中。3.1.打开 cmd, 切换到项目根目录, 输入指令 npm install 包名@版本号 || npm i 包名@版本号。●切换到项目根目录, 打开 cmd 输入 npm init --yes || npm init -y。3.2.注意: 安装时, package 中只会记录一个, 后续安装的, 会顶替掉之前安装的。○输入指令: npm --version || npm -v。原创 2023-06-12 14:35:59 · 672 阅读 · 0 评论 -
JavaScript全解析——Ajax(下)
●http 传输协议○http(s) 协议规定了, 只能由前端主动发起○并且在传输的过程中, 只能传递 字符串●http 协议过程1.建立连接浏览器和服务器进行连接建立基于 TCP/IP 协议的三次握手2.发送请求要求前端必须以 请求报文 的形式发送报文由浏览器组装, 我们只需要提供对应的信息即可报文包含的内容3.接收响应要求后端必须以响应报文的形式返回报文由服务器组装响应报文包含的内容响应报文行响应状态码, 简单信息描述响应状态码, 传输协议。原创 2023-06-08 14:55:53 · 971 阅读 · 0 评论 -
JavaScript全解析——Ajax(上)
●认识前后端交互○就是 前端 与 后端的 一种通讯方式○主要使用的技术栈就是 ajax (async javascript and xml)●ajax 特点○使用 ajax 技术网页应用能够快速的将新内容呈现在用户界面○并且不需要刷新整个页面, 也就是能够让页面有 "无刷更新" 的效果●注意点:○前后端交互只能交互 字符串○并且有自己的固定步骤创建ajax 基本步骤的是什么1.创建 ajax 对象2.配置 ajax 对象3.发送请求xhr.send()4.接收响应。原创 2023-06-08 14:54:31 · 881 阅读 · 0 评论 -
JavaScript全解析——node实现mongodb数据库的操作
问node要实现MongoDB数据库的操作总共分几步?原创 2023-06-06 17:25:30 · 342 阅读 · 0 评论 -
JavaScript全解析——Express框架介绍与入门
■而我们接收到token后, 需要解密token, 验证是否为正确的 token 或者 过期的 token。■比如用户需要访问一些需要登陆后才能访问的接口, 就可以把登录时返回的token保存下来。a. 假设你需要请求的是 ‘./client/views/index.html’ 文件。把启动服务器包括操作的一系列内容进行的完整的封装,不过在使用之前, 需要下载第三方。b.你的请求地址需要书写 ‘/static/views/index.html’●以什么开头: 可以不写, 写的话需要是字符串。原创 2023-05-29 17:34:03 · 702 阅读 · 0 评论 -
JavaScript全解析——ES6函数中参数的默认值和解构赋值
ES6允许按照一定的模式,从数组或对象中提取值,给变量进行赋值,称为解构赋值。当你起了别名以后, 原先的键名不能在当做变量名使用了, 需要使用这个别名。函数的默认值是给函数的形参设置一个默认值, 当你没有传递实参的时候来使用。直接在书写形参的时候, 以赋值符号(=) 给形参设置默认值就可以了。给函数的形参设置一个默认值, 当你没有传递实参的时候, 使用默认值。会按照数组的索引依次把数组中的数据拿出来,赋值给对应的变量。数组怎么写, 解构怎么写,把数据换成变量。快速的从数组拿到数组中的数据。原创 2023-05-19 19:12:19 · 1564 阅读 · 0 评论 -
JavaScript全解析——Ajax教程(上)
前后端交互就是前端与后端的一种通讯方式,主要使用的技术栈就是。原创 2023-05-18 15:48:18 · 622 阅读 · 0 评论 -
JavaScript字符串常用方法
●语法: substring(从哪个索引开始,到哪个索引截止),包含开始索引,不包含结束索引。●作用:charAt() 是找到字符串中指定索引位置的内容返回。●语法:字符串.repalce(被替换的内容,要替换的内容)●语法:字符串.indexOf(要查找的字符,开始索引)●语法:字符串.indexOf(要查找的字符,开始索引)○(' ') 字符串中有空格 会按照原字符串中的空格切割。●字符串和数组有一个一样的地方,也是按照索引来排列的。○包含开始的索引对应的内容,不包含结束索引对应的内容。原创 2023-05-17 16:01:14 · 330 阅读 · 0 评论 -
【JavaScript全解析】ES6定义变量与箭头函数详解
我们现在知道定义(声明)一个变量用的是varlet和const用let声明的变量也叫变量用const声明的变零叫产量。原创 2023-05-16 14:13:08 · 500 阅读 · 0 评论 -
JavaScript全解析——this指向
本系列内容为JS全解析,为千锋教育资深前端老师独家创作致力于为大家讲解清晰JavaScript相关知识点,含有丰富的代码案例及讲解。如果感觉对大家有帮助的话,可以【点个关注】持续追更~this 是一个关键字,是一个使用在作用域内的关键字作用域分为全局作用域和局部作用域(私有作用域或者函数作用域)全局作用域中this指向window函数内的 this, 和 函数如何定义没有关系, 和 函数在哪定义也没有关系,只看函数是如何被调用的(箭头函数除外)可分为以下场景:普通函数中的this和全局调用一样,this指向原创 2023-05-16 10:57:55 · 560 阅读 · 2 评论 -
JavaScript全解析——本地存储的概念、用法详解
如果 sessionStorage 中有该条数据 获取到的就是该条数据的值。+如果localStorage 中有这条数据 拿到的就是这个条数据的值。+如果localStorage 中没有这条数据 拿到的就是 null。2.可以跨页面通讯, 也就是说在一个页面写下在另一个页面可以读取。=> 本地打开的页面是不能操作 cookie。=> 只要 cookie 空间中有内容的时候。=> 会在该页面和后端交互的过程中自动携带。=> 哪一个域名存储, 哪一个域名使用。=> 任何一个后端语言都可以操作。原创 2023-05-04 13:20:13 · 597 阅读 · 0 评论 -
JavaScript全解析——常见的BOM操作(下)
本篇为JavaScript全解析,常见的BOM操作下篇,上篇可以。原创 2023-04-28 15:00:00 · 714 阅读 · 0 评论 -
JavaScript全解析——常见的BOM操作(上)
本文将为大家详细介绍JS中常见的BOM操作,由于内容过多,我们分为上下两部分。原创 2023-04-27 18:14:48 · 527 阅读 · 0 评论 -
JavaScript字符串操作
字符串是一种数据类型,是连续的字符序列,由数字,字母和符号组成。在字符串的每个字符只占用一个字节,在JS内用单引号、 双引号或者反引号(ES6中称为模板字符串)包裹存储的时候, 是以基本数据类型的形式进行存储,当你使用它的时候, 会瞬间转换成复杂数据类型的样子让你使用等你使用完毕, 瞬间转换成基本数据类型的形式进行存储这3个基本类型都有自己对应的包装对象。包装对象其实就是对象,有相应的属性和方法。调用方法的过程是在偷偷发生的,所以我们称为基本包装类型。原创 2023-04-25 17:10:53 · 476 阅读 · 0 评论 -
零基础入门前端--JavaScript 循环结构语句
○,可以是【任意数据类型值】○是指【改变起始值的方式】○,它是循环停止的边界。原创 2023-04-21 17:52:09 · 400 阅读 · 0 评论 -
JavaScript的作用域
但是如果在当前作用域中没有查找到值,就会向上级作用域去查找,直到查找到全局作用域,这么一个查找过程形成的链条就叫做作用域链。●由于变量的查找是沿着作用域链来实现的,所以也称作用域链为变量查找的机制。○变量不是在所有地方都可以使用的,而这个变量的使用范围就是作用域。○你在哪一个作用域下书写的函数, 就是哪一个作用域的子级作用域。●你定义在哪一个作用域下的变量,就是哪一个作用域的私有变量。○首先,在自己的作用域内部查找,如果有,就直接拿来使用。○如果没有,就去上一级作用域查找,如果有,就拿来使用。原创 2023-04-18 14:44:44 · 341 阅读 · 0 评论 -
JavaScript 条件分支语句
●if 或 else if 的条件存在数据隐式类型的转换●else 只能跟在 if 或 else if,之后,从语法角度看 else 可以省略●支持嵌套。原创 2023-04-18 11:13:32 · 626 阅读 · 0 评论 -
JavaScript基础入门全解析(下)
●是指我们存储在内存中的数据的分类,为了方便数据的管理,将数据分成了不同的类型●我们通常分为两大类 基本数据类型 和 复杂数据类型(引用数据类型)原创 2023-04-17 16:33:44 · 440 阅读 · 0 评论 -
JavaScript函数基础
●函数的本质是封装(包裹),函数体内的逻辑执行完毕后,函数外部如何获得函数内部的执行结果呢?要想获得函数内部逻辑的执行结果,需要通过 return 这个关键字,将内部执行结果传递到函数外部,这个被传递到外部的结果就是返回值。●声明(定义)函数时括号中的变量叫做形参,调用函数时括号中的数据为实参,实参是专门为形参赋值的。●我们代码里面所说的函数和我们上学的时候学习的什么三角函数、二次函数之类的不是一个东西。●函数名的命名规则与变量是一致的,并且尽量保证函数名的语义。原创 2023-04-17 14:54:08 · 348 阅读 · 0 评论 -
JavaScript基础入门全解析(上)
本篇文章将详细介绍JavaScript的基础语法及JS的一些基础知识点原创 2023-04-13 15:16:09 · 398 阅读 · 0 评论